tumbuhanalga
Tumbuhanalga is the Indonesian term commonly used to refer to algae, a broad and diverse group of photosynthetic organisms that are not restricted to land plants. The concept encompasses a range of organisms from simple, single-celled microalgae to large, multicellular seaweeds. Algae are found in a variety of aquatic environments, including oceans, rivers, lakes, and moist terrestrial surfaces.
